WebA hernia is a defect or a hole in the muscle layer of the abdominal wall. In an umbilical hernia, which is sometimes called a belly button hernia, this hole is under the belly button. Everyone is born with a natural hole in the muscle layer at the belly button because this is where the umbilical cord entered the body. WebIn an umbilical hernia, the umbilical cord, which connects a fetus to its mother while in the womb, pushes through the umbilical ring in the belly button. It occurs as a soft lump in the skin around or under the belly button. Umbilical hernias mostly occur in infants (especially in premature infants or those with low birth weight) but can form ...
